Netravati Weekday Trek – The Western Ghats Without the Weekend Crowd


One of the most picturesque trekking routes in Karnataka's Western Ghats is the Netravati weekday Trek. The trek, which is well-known for its misty trails, rolling green hills, and stunning panoramic views, is situated in the Chikkamagaluru district, close to the village of Samse.

The trek typically starts at the forest check post close to Samse and travels through thick forest before emerging into expansive grasslands. Trekkers can enjoy breathtaking views of the surrounding Western Ghats as they ascend higher through the landscape, which changes into lovely ridges blanketed in floating clouds and lush greenery. At an elevation of approximately 1,520 meters (4,987 feet), the peak is regarded as a moderate-level trek, appropriate for novices with rudimentary fitness.

The round-trip trekking distance is 12 km, and it usually takes 5–6 hours to finish. The trek's proximity to the Netravathi River birthplace, which runs through Karnataka before joining the Arabian Sea close to Mangaluru, is one of its distinctive features.

June through February are the ideal months to visit Netravati weekday Peak because of the region's lush vegetation and mist, which make for an amazing trekking experience. Trekkers can see colorful grasslands, cool weather, and dramatic cloud movements along the mountain ridges during the monsoon and post-monsoon seasons.

Since permission from the forest department is needed because the trek passes through a forest area close to Kudremukh National Park, many hikers opt to travel with local guides or organized trekking groups.

1. What is the Netravathi Trek in Karnataka?
The Netravathi Trek is a scenic Western Ghats trek leading to Netravathi Peak, known for its lush forests, streams, meadows, and breathtaking summit views.

2. Where is Netravathi Peak located?
Netravathi Peak is located in the Samse region of Kudremukh National Park, in the Western Ghats.

3. How far is Netravathi Trek from Bengaluru?
The trek base is around 330–350 km from Bengaluru, which usually takes 7–8 hours by road.

4. What is the difficulty level of the Netravathi Trek?
The trek is moderate to difficult, mainly due to steep ascents near the summit.

5. What is the total distance of the Netravathi Trek?
The total trekking distance is approximately 12–14 km (round trip).

6. Do we need forest permission for Netravathi Trek?
Yes, trekking to Netravathi Peak requires forest department permission, which is usually arranged by the trek organizers.

7. What is the best time to do the Netravathi Trek?
The best time to trek is June to December, especially during the monsoon and post-monsoon seasons when the Western Ghats are lush and green.
